“At least 655 Ethiopians killed by Saudi guards”- HRW

At least 655 Ethiopians killed by Saudi guards- HRW

Human Rights Watch has accused Saudi Arabian border guards of systematically killing hundreds of Ethiopian economic migrants trying to cross from war-torn Yemen, the BBC reported. The rights group said at least 655 people have been killed by guards since early last year. Some were shot, others killed or maimed …

ECOWAS rejects Niger’s three-year transition plan

ECOWAS rejects Niger's three-year transition plan

The Economic Community of West African States (ECOWAS) has rejected the Nigerien coup leader’s plan to lead the country for three years before restoring civilian rule. The organisation’s political commissioner, Abdel-Fatau Musa, said the timetable was unacceptable. On Saturday, Gen Abdourahamane Tchiani said a national dialogue was needed to lay …
